Preferably, an inclined guide plate is arranged at the left end of the conveying groove, and a cushion pad is arranged on one side, far away from the machine body, of the collecting groove.
Preferably, the supporting piece comprises fixing plates symmetrically arranged, fixing rods are arranged on one opposite sides of the fixing plates, accommodating grooves are formed in the fixing plates, threaded rods are arranged in the accommodating grooves, guide blocks are arranged between the bottoms of the threaded rods and the accommodating grooves, nuts matched with the threaded rods are movably arranged on the rear sides of the fixing rods, supporting blocks are installed at the other ends of the threaded rods, and the supporting blocks are of L-shaped structures.
Preferably, the first detection box and the second detection box are internally provided with light absorption plates, the inner wall of one side of each light absorption plate opposite to the light absorption plate is provided with a detection camera, illuminating lamps are symmetrically arranged on two sides of each detection camera, and the rear sides of the inner cavities of the first detection box and the second detection box are provided with marking nozzles.
Preferably, the conveyer belt passes through a first detection box and a second detection box, and the first detection box and the second detection box are arranged in an up-and-down overturning manner.
Preferably, the two ends of the first detection box and the second detection box are respectively provided with a shading plate in an up-and-down symmetrical manner.

Example two
As shown in fig. 1-4, a double-sided visual inspection apparatus for PCB board according to an embodiment of the present invention comprises a machine body 1, the machine body 1 is provided with a conveying groove 2, a conveying belt 3 is arranged in the conveying groove 2, a placing groove 4 is arranged on the conveying belt 3, a support piece 5 is arranged in the placing groove 4, a first detection box 6 and a second detection box 7 are arranged on the conveyer belt 3, a supporting plate 8 is arranged at the left end of the machine body 1, a collecting tank 9 is arranged on the supporting plate 8, a tank 10 to be detected is arranged at one side of the conveying tank 2, a supporting box 11 is arranged at the right end of the machine body 1, a display 12 is arranged at the top of the supporting box 11, a data processor 13 is arranged in the supporting box 11, light absorbing plates 22 are arranged in the first detection box 6 and the second detection box 7, a detection camera 23 is arranged on the inner wall of one side of the light absorption plate 22 opposite to the light absorption plate, illuminating lamps 24 are symmetrically arranged on two sides of the detection camera 23, the rear sides of the inner cavities of the first detection box 6 and the second detection box 7 are provided with a marking spray head 25, the conveying belt 3 passes through the first detection box 6 and the second detection box 7, the first detection box 6 and the second detection box 7 are arranged in an up-and-down overturning way, the PCB is conveyed by the conveyer belt 3 to enter the first detection box 6 and the second detection box 7 in sequence, the two ends of the first detection box 6 and the second detection box 7 are respectively provided with a shading plate 26 in an up-and-down symmetrical way, after entering, the lighting lamp 24 illuminates the PCB, the detection camera 23 performs detection photographing, meanwhile, the light absorption plate 22 and the light shielding plate 26 reduce the influence of ambient light on the detection camera 23, and then, after the system analysis is carried out through the data processor 13, the unqualified products are sprayed and marked through the marking spray head 25, so that the separation inspection is convenient.

2. The PCB double-sided visual inspection device of claim 1, wherein the left end of the conveying groove (2) is provided with an inclined guide plate (14), and the side of the collecting groove (9) far away from the machine body (1) is provided with a cushion pad.
3. The PCB double-sided visual inspection device of claim 1, wherein the supporting member (5) comprises fixing plates (15) symmetrically arranged, fixing rods (16) are arranged on opposite sides of the fixing plates (15), accommodating grooves (17) are formed in the fixing plates (15), threaded rods (18) are arranged in the accommodating grooves (17), guide blocks (19) are arranged between the bottoms of the threaded rods (18) and the accommodating grooves (17), nuts (20) matched with the threaded rods (18) are movably arranged on the rear sides of the fixing rods (16), supporting blocks (21) are mounted at the other ends of the threaded rods (18), and the supporting blocks (21) are L-shaped structures.
4. The PCB double-sided visual inspection device according to claim 1, wherein light absorption plates (22) are arranged in the first inspection box (6) and the second inspection box (7), an inspection camera (23) is mounted on the inner wall of one side of the light absorption plates (22) opposite to the inner wall of the inspection camera (23), illuminating lamps (24) are symmetrically arranged on two sides of the inspection camera (23), and marking nozzles (25) are arranged on the rear sides of the inner cavities of the first inspection box (6) and the second inspection box (7).
5. The PCB double-sided visual inspection equipment of claim 4, wherein the conveyer belt (3) passes through a first inspection box (6) and a second inspection box (7), and the first inspection box (6) and the second inspection box (7) are arranged in an up-and-down overturning manner.
6. The PCB double-sided visual inspection equipment as claimed in claim 5, wherein the two ends of the first inspection box (6) and the second inspection box (7) are provided with light shielding plates (26) in an up-and-down symmetrical manner.
